How to Create a Ticket in HubSpot When a Schedule is Registered in Calendly

Since we will set up automation, please click "Try it" on the banner below.

You will be redirected to the following screen, where you can check the "Title" and "Description" and make changes on the following page if necessary.
First, start with the Calendly settings, and click on "When an event is scheduled."

Please check the following settings.

  • "App Trigger Title" → Set as desired
  • "Account Information to Integrate with Calendly" → Check for discrepancies
  • "Trigger Action" → When an event is scheduled (Webhook activation)

You will be redirected to the following screen, where you should select the "Organization URI" from the options.
Click "Test" → "Test Successful" → "Save."

You will be redirected to the following screen, where you should send a Webhook event or execute the event.
Click "Test" → "Test Successful" → "Save."

Next, proceed with the HubSpot settings by clicking "Create Ticket."
Once you are redirected to the following screen, check the settings.

  • "Title" → Set as desired
  • "Account Information to Integrate with HubSpot" → Check for discrepancies
  • "Action" → Create Ticket

Please make the following settings.

  • "Ticket Name" → Set as desired
  • "Pipeline Stage" → Specify the internal value of the applicable pipeline, e.g., 1

For "Ticket Description," enter the Calendly output to display the details of the Calendly event.
The output can be used by clicking on the red-framed section.
Please refer to the example below.

If there are any other necessary fields, please fill them in.
Click "Test" → "Test Successful" → "Save."

Once you turn the app trigger "ON," the automation setup is complete.
